Today's view of Halema‘uma‘u and the water at the bottom of the crater is from a slightly different angle than previous photos. The main pond appears larger from this site because its entire perimeter can be seen. USGS photo by D. Swanson, 08-07-2019.
The main (larger) pond of water, first identified on July 25, is still isolated, but this telephoto view shows that only 3-6 m (about 10-20 ft) separate it from the other two, now coalesced, ponds. Measurements today indicate a possible increase in pond level of several tens of centimeters (up to about 12 inches) since yesterday morning. USGS photo by D. Swanson, 08-07-2019.
